Message type: E = Error
Message class: EDOCUMENT_BR - eDocument Brazil Message Class
Message number: 123
Message text: Item & not found for document number &.

- Item & not found for document number &. ?The SAP error message EDOCUMENT_BR123 indicates that a specific item associated with a document number could not be found in the system. This error typically arises in the context of electronic document processing, such as when dealing with e-invoicing or electronic document management.
Cause:
- Missing Item: The item referenced in the error message does not exist in the database for the specified document number.
- Incorrect Document Number: The document number provided may be incorrect or not formatted properly.
- Data Synchronization Issues: There may be a delay or issue in data synchronization between different modules or systems.
- Deletion or Archiving: The item may have been deleted or archived, making it unavailable for retrieval.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to access the item or document.
Solution:
- Verify Document Number: Check the document number for accuracy. Ensure that it is correctly entered and corresponds to an existing document.
- Check Item Existence: Use transaction codes like SE16 or SE11 to query the relevant database tables and confirm whether the item exists for the specified document number.
- Review Data Synchronization: If the system integrates with other applications, ensure that data synchronization is functioning correctly and that there are no pending updates.
- Check for Deletion/Archiving: Investigate whether the item has been deleted or archived. If it has been archived, you may need to restore it or access it through the archive.
- User Authorization: Ensure that the user encountering the error has the necessary authorizations to view the document and its items.
- Consult Logs: Check system log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
